What is a Python developer intern?

A Python Developer Intern is an entry-level role where interns assist in developing, testing, and maintaining software applications using Python. They work under the guidance of senior developers to write clean and efficient code, debug issues, and collaborate with teams on various projects. Interns may also gain experience with frameworks like Django or Flask, databases, and APIs. This role helps build hands-on programming skills and provides valuable industry experience for future opportunities.

What types of projects or tasks can I expect to work on as a Python developer intern?

As a Python Developer Intern, you may work on a variety of tasks ranging from writing and testing code to debugging existing applications and developing new features under the supervision of senior developers. You could be involved in supporting ongoing software development projects, automating routine processes, or contributing to data analysis efforts, depending on the team's focus. Interns often collaborate with mentors and other team members through code reviews, stand-up meetings, and paired programming sessions. This hands-on experience provides valuable exposure to industry best practices and helps build a strong foundation for future advancement within software development roles.
